Rail transit is one of the most demanding fields for battery applications. Operating in all-weather conditions with continuous vibration and extreme temperature swings, the battery systems must offer top-tier safety redundancy (e.g., fire and explosion resistance), an ultra-long cycle and float service life exceeding a decade, and stable output across a wide temperature range (e.g., -40°C to 60°C). They provide power not only for auxiliary systems like lighting, air conditioning, and door controls but also serve as the critical backup power source to ensure emergency ventilation, safety lighting, and continuous operation of vital control systems in case of primary power failure, safeguarding passenger safety and operational integrity.
